So today Skype has served me in more ways than one. The new-aged tool for communicating for free helped me reach a friend in China, my Omaha-mama, a French friend 15 minutes away, and even a friend in Chicago. And it was all from my wee little Mac. Props, technology.

 

But Skype has a secret its not telling you.

 

First of all, for those of you who have yet to discover "Skype," here's a brief description:

Passez des appels sur votre ordinateur. Ils sont gratuits entre utilisateurs de Skype et à tarif réduit vers des téléphones fixes et mobiles partout dans le monde. En outre, la qualité audio est extraordinaire. Laissez-le ouvert toute la journée et c'est comme si vous vous trouviez dans la même pièce que votre interlocuteur.

and in English:

"Make free calls on your computer. They're free between any other Skype users and offered at a reduced price for home phones and mobiles everywhere in the world. Plus, the sound quality is extraordinary. Leave it open during the day, and it's like you're in the same room as the person you're talking to**!"

So now I can fill you in on the magical secret that makes Skype even sexier:

 

the possibility of a three-way.

 

That's right friends, on Skype you can ménage à trois with your loved ones. Though the video capability is mitigated when you switch to a three-person call, three Skype users can talk and hear each other at the same time. It's brilliant!
